The BSc (Hons) Computer Science (Information Systems) program is designed to equip students with the skills and knowledge needed to thrive in the fast-paced world of technology. From programming fundamentals to database management and cybersecurity, students will gain a broad understanding of both computer science theory and practical applications.
| Module | Description |
|---|---|
| Programming Fundamentals | Introduction to programming languages such as Java, Python, and C++ |
| Database Management | Learn about database design, SQL queries, and data warehousing |
| Cybersecurity | Explore the principles of cybersecurity and how to protect information systems |
| Information Systems Management | Understand how to design and implement effective information systems for organizations |

BSc (Hons) Computer Science (Information Systems) is an 18-month degree that equips students with the skills to design, develop, and implement effective information systems.
This course is ideal for those interested in the business side of computing, focusing on the practical application of computer science to real-world problems.
Through a combination of theoretical foundations and hands-on experience, students will learn to analyze business needs, design solutions, and implement them using a range of technologies.
Some of the key topics covered include: data structures, algorithms, software engineering, database systems, and human-computer interaction.
Graduates of this course will be well-prepared to pursue careers in a variety of industries, including finance, healthcare, and government.
